France Q3 2025: Top 5 MOBA Apps Performance on Unified Platform

In the third quarter of 2025, the top five MOBA applications in France showed varied performance in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users on a unified platform. Here's a closer look at each app's trends based on data from Sensor Tower.

League of Legends: Wild Rift from Riot Games saw a notable fluctuation in weekly revenue, peaking at $115K in the final week of September. Weekly downloads experienced a decline from 3K to just over 2K, while active users decreased from around 51K to 39K by the end of the quarter.

Mobile Legends: Bang Bang by MOONTON maintained a relatively stable performance. Revenue peaked at $61K in early September, and downloads hovered around 3K to 4K throughout the quarter. Active users declined from 58K to 33K.

Honor of Kings, developed by Level Infinite, had a steady rise in weekly revenue, reaching $9.8K in early September. Downloads remained modest, peaking at around 2.2K, while active users increased from 5.6K to 7.3K.

Pokémon UNITE from The Pokémon Company showed consistent weekly revenue, averaging around $6K. Downloads were strong, peaking at 5.1K mid-quarter. However, active users saw a significant drop from 77K to 24K.

DRAGON BALL GEKISHIN SQUADRA by Bandai Namco Entertainment Inc. launched in September with an impressive start, achieving $25K in revenue in its third week. Downloads began at 100K but fell to 7K by the quarter's end, while active users dropped from 65K to 9K.
